Arrangements for the 2021 O’Gorman cup are presently being put in place by the competition organisers, Doonbeg GAA.

First organised in 2006 when Lissycasey were the inaugural winners, the competition commemorates John O’Gorman who devoted many years to Doonbeg and Clare GAA.

Clubs wishing to take part in this year’s competition are asked to contact Doonbeg GAA.

While there are no dates yet for the return of GAA club games, the competition organisers are keen to have details of the format and the participants in place once a return of GAA club games is given the go ahead.

Since its introduction, the competition has been played without the involvement of inter county players. The final is played each year at Shanahan-McNamara Park in Doonbeg.
